Output 09375a0cfe07c818effe8d4273a4bc3bfeb301161dbde51a761fb94496d83493:0

value
668300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840adcff976a1ef52c9c56e20283fb968027e92f OP_EQUAL
address
3DjC8fAxfHhCkuEYDPRr2QvL9vGaD7phcY
transaction
09375a0cfe07c818effe8d4273a4bc3bfeb301161dbde51a761fb94496d83493
spent
true